one question though why does the max shown not equal the 200,000 Asteroids selected I quite often see over 300K as shown

Default rasterization and compute rasterization modes use shadow maps. That requires an additional geometry pass and increases the overall number of instances.
Raytracing rendering mode doesn't require it and the geometry count is always constant.

My recently aquired Sapphire Pulse RX6750XT was tested and below are the Vulkan API's results in 4 different configs/profiles mainly trying to optimize for efficiency and to have a low power tune for not demanding games for my 1080P monitor.

34,3K@Stock (2,7GHz@1,2V with 173W average die power draw)
GravityMark(VK)_Default clocks&voltage.jpg

34,4@default UV setting from the driver suite (2,7GHz@1,175V with 168W average die power draw)
GravityMark(VK)_UV@1,175v.jpg

33,4K@manual UV setting with fast timings for the VRAM (2,6GHz@1,175V with 138W average die power draw)
GravityMark(VK)_2,6GHz@1,175v&FastVRAM.jpg

27,5K@manual low power setting (2GHz@1V with 91W average die power draw)

GravityMark(VK)_2GHz@1v.jpg

This last one resulted also in 1810 efficiency points
https://gravitymark.tellusim.com/report/?id=431d829625c3fc3f05425dabfde55e92e9d209a9
 
Another undervolting tune got almost 1800 efficiency points @1080P and more than 1500 @1440P while maintaining 90% of the stock performance. I set clocks at 2300MHz and voltage at 1,125V that in real ended at just 0,97V with max 110W of power draw and 30K@1080P and ~27K@1440P points in the benchmark.

The wattage shown there is the same AMD driver shows which is not the total board power draw. Usually you have to add 20-40W (depending to the GPU) to get the total figure. And the figure the screenshot shows isn't the maximum of this benchmark. Mine reached 210W at one instance but in the end it shows just 187W.

The new version 1.78 is ready with:
  • Additional command line parameters for batch scripts.
  • Correct VK_EXT_mesh_shader bytecode generation.
  • Fan Speed sensor visualization.
  • OpenXR support for Linux.
  • FPS chart in reports.
And finally, multi-GPU Vulkan works with the latest Nvidia drivers on Linux.
